Finding the Best Leash for Your German Shepherd

German Shepherds are strong, intelligent, and active dogs. They need a leash that can handle their strength and keep them safe during walks and training. Choosing the right leash is important for both you and your furry friend. This guide will help you find the perfect leash for your German Shepherd.

Key Features to Look For

When you shop for a leash, keep these important features in mind.

Durability

A strong leash will last longer. It needs to withstand your German Shepherd’s pulling power. Look for leashes made with tough materials.

Comfortable Grip

You will be holding the leash for a while. A comfortable grip prevents your hand from getting sore. Padded handles are a great option.

Length

The length of the leash affects how much control you have. Shorter leashes (4-6 feet) are good for training and busy areas. Longer leashes give your dog more freedom to explore.

Secure Clasp

The clasp connects the leash to your dog’s collar or harness. It must be strong and reliable. A faulty clasp can lead to your dog running away.

Reflective Elements

If you walk your dog at night or in low light, reflective leashes are a lifesaver. They make you and your dog more visible to cars.

Important Materials

The material of a leash plays a big role in its strength and feel.

Nylon

Nylon is a very popular choice. It is strong, lightweight, and water-resistant. Many strong leashes use nylon.

Leather

Leather leashes are classic and durable. They feel nice in your hand and get softer with age. High-quality leather is a good investment.

Biothane

Biothane is a synthetic material that looks like leather but is waterproof and easy to clean. It is very strong and doesn’t stretch.

Rope

Some rope leashes are made from strong materials like climbing rope. They can be very durable but might be rough on your hands.

User Experience and Use Cases

How you use the leash matters. Different situations call for different leashes.

Everyday Walks

A standard 6-foot nylon leash is perfect for daily walks. It offers good control and allows your dog some freedom.

Training and Control

For training your German Shepherd, a shorter leash (4 feet) gives you more immediate control. This helps teach commands like “heel.”

Hiking and Adventure

When you’re out on trails, a hands-free leash can be useful. This attaches to your waist, leaving your hands free for balance or snacks. Some leashes have multiple handle options for different situations.

Busy Urban Environments

In crowded places, a sturdy, shorter leash is essential. It helps you keep your dog close and prevents them from getting tangled or running off.


Frequently Asked Questions About German Shepherd Leashes

Q: What is the best length for a German Shepherd leash?

A: For most German Shepherds, a 6-foot leash is ideal. It offers a good balance of control and freedom for everyday walks. Shorter leashes (4 feet) are better for training and busy areas.

Q: Should I use a collar or a harness with my German Shepherd’s leash?

A: Both can work. Many owners prefer harnesses for German Shepherds. They distribute pressure more evenly, which can be gentler on your dog’s neck, especially if they pull. Always ensure the collar or harness fits well.

Q: How do I clean a German Shepherd leash?

A: Nylon and Biothane leashes are easy to clean. You can usually wipe them down with a damp cloth and mild soap. Leather leashes need special leather cleaner and conditioner to keep them in good shape.

Q: Are retractable leashes good for German Shepherds?

A: Generally, retractable leashes are not recommended for strong dogs like German Shepherds. They offer less control and can cause injury to both the dog and owner if the dog suddenly pulls hard. They can also teach dogs to pull.

Q: How strong does a leash need to be for a German Shepherd?

A: German Shepherds are powerful dogs. You need a leash made from strong materials like heavy-duty nylon, leather, or Biothane. Look for leashes that can handle at least 100-200 pounds of force.

Q: What is a good leash material if my German Shepherd swims a lot?

A: Biothane is an excellent choice for dogs who swim. It is waterproof, doesn’t absorb odor, and is very easy to clean after a dip.

Q: How can I tell if a leash is good quality?

A: Look for reinforced stitching, solid metal hardware (like clasps and D-rings), and durable, tightly woven materials. A comfortable, padded handle also indicates better quality.

Q: When should I consider a reflective leash?

A: If you walk your German Shepherd in the early morning, late evening, or at night, a reflective leash is a must. It increases your visibility to cars and cyclists, making your walks safer.

Q: Can a leash be too short for a German Shepherd?

A: Yes, a leash can be too short. If a leash is too short, your dog might feel restricted and uncomfortable. It also makes it harder for them to sniff and explore, which is important for their well-being.

Q: What is the difference between a leash and a lead?

A: In most cases, the terms “leash” and “lead” are used interchangeably to mean the strap used to walk a dog. There isn’t a significant difference in common usage.
